How To Start Playing At A Casino With Neosurf

Buy a Neosurf voucher first. You can get it at participating convenience stores and newsagents, then pay in cash or by card depending on the retailer. The voucher comes with a printed 10-digit PIN and a fixed value, so you know the exact deposit amount before you open the casino cashier.

Create a casino account, open the cashier, select Neosurf, and enter the PIN to fund your balance. Neosurf works for deposits only, so plan your withdrawal method upfront (for example, a bank transfer or e-wallet in your name) to avoid delays later. When you deposit, double-check the currency and the minimum deposit shown in the cashier, because vouchers can’t be “partly refunded” if you enter the full PIN amount.

What do I need to start paying with Neosurf?

You need a Neosurf voucher with a 10-digit code and enough balance for your deposit. Buy the voucher from an authorised retailer (often newsagents and convenience stores) or through an approved online seller in your country.

How do I make a first deposit with a Neosurf voucher?

Open the casino cashier, pick Neosurf , enter the voucher code, and confirm the amount. The deposit can’t exceed the remaining balance on the voucher, and any deposit limits set by the casino still apply.

Can I split one voucher across multiple deposits?

Yes, a voucher works until its balance reaches zero. If the cashier asks for the full amount and your voucher balance is short, top up with another voucher code if the casino supports adding multiple codes in one deposit.

Why was my Neosurf deposit declined?

Common reasons are an incorrect code, not enough balance on the voucher, the voucher being blocked after too many wrong attempts, or the casino not accepting Neosurf in your location. Check the code carefully and confirm Neosurf is available for your country and currency.

Can I withdraw winnings back to Neosurf?

No, Neosurf is a prepaid voucher for deposits only. Casinos pay withdrawals to other methods, such as a bank transfer or an e-wallet, and they may ask you to verify your identity before processing a payout.

How To Set Up A Neosurf Account Or Wallet

  1. Check what “Neosurf” means in your country. In many places, Neosurf works as prepaid vouchers (no account needed). In some regions, Neosurf also offers an online wallet through local partners or a Neosurf portal.
  2. Go to the official Neosurf site and pick your region. Open neosurf.com, select your country, and follow the link provided for “MyNeosurf” / wallet access if it’s available where you live.
  3. Create your wallet login. Enter your email address, set a password, and confirm your email if the site sends a verification link.
  4. Complete identity checks if they appear. Some regions require a phone number, date of birth, and ID verification before the wallet can be used for payments or higher limits.
  5. Add funds and confirm it works. Top up using a Neosurf voucher PIN (or the funding method shown for your region), then make a small test payment or check the balance to confirm the wallet is active.

First Deposit With Neosurf

A sensible first Neosurf deposit is €20–€50. This range keeps fees low (Neosurf vouchers are sold in fixed amounts) and gives you enough balance to meet most minimum deposit rules, which are commonly €10–€20. Deposit the exact voucher value where possible, because many casinos don’t accept partial voucher redemptions and you can end up with unused credit on the voucher.

To activate a first-deposit bonus, enter the promo code on the cashier or deposit screen before confirming the payment, then complete the deposit in one transaction. Check three points before you click “Confirm”: (1) Neosurf is listed as an eligible payment method for the bonus, because some offers exclude vouchers; (2) the minimum deposit for the bonus matches your voucher value; (3) the wagering rules and time limit are stated in numbers (for example, “x35 within 7 days”) and include any game contribution limits that can slow down clearance.
